Federica Montseny i Mañé (February 12, 1905, MadridJanuary 14, 1994) was a Spanish anarchist, intellectual and Minister of Health during the social revolution that occurred in Spain parallel to the Civil War. Federica Montseny was, in her own words, the [d]aughter of a family of old anarchists; her father was the anti-authoritarian writer and propagandist Joan Montseny (Federico Urales); her mother, Soledad Gustavo, was herself an anarchist activist. She was the first ever female minister in the Spanish government, and as minister she aimed to transform public health to meet the needs of the poor and working class. Félix Martí Ibáñez, the anarchist director general of Health and Social Assistance of the Generalitat de Catalunya, issued the Eugenic Reform of Abortion, a decree effectively making abortion on demand legal in Catalonia. Given her family libertarian tradition, the decision to enter the Popular Front government was especially difficult.
